Teaching style

I love to make music education fun and well-rounded! I believe students should be reading and writing about music long before college, and I create curriculum for students that works as a supplementary lesson within ensemble classes that requires no prep work for teachers, but allows students to explore music while hitting National Core Arts Standards, and gives opportunities to explore music genres outside of their ensemble disciplines. I also know that music and English Language Arts go hand in hand, and many of my lessons are cross-curricular promoting literacy and language skills through the medium of music.
